Regarding the Striper, I had an 18 footer walkaround once, with a 150 Johnson. I really liked that boat. Things I liked on it; standing at the helm, the cockpit jumpseats that came with it, the 50 gallon tank under the flat deck. Things I didn't like, the decal of a swordfish and the word "Striper" on the hull, the thin fiberglass that the sun could shine thru, the carpeted bulkheads in the cutty, and the patterned upholstery on the seats. It was a fast fun little boat, and a lot of boat for the money. Enjoy. _________________ MartyP

Most of the "issues" of the photo posting in the galleries, seem to stem from photos which are too large files. If you pare down, or keep the file size small, they upload quickly. The other issue, seems to be with advertising blockers.
I would strongly object to Facebook pages. They would not represent the group well, even if photos were much easier to post. There would not be the easy search, the archives, and the site would be way too "public".. Just my opinion.d
I had a 20' Grady White "Weekender" walk around--very similar to the Striiper 20--even came with a 150 Honda--which was shot, and I put a 225 on it--got over 50 mph. Great boat for rough water and offshore fishing--not so good for sleeping overnight, bay fishing, and economy. You will enjoy the Striper and the 20* dead rise on trips when there is some chop offshore. These type of boats are ideal for many folks. _________________ Bob Austin
